It really works by improving something called steroidogenic intense regulatory (StAR) protein, which is a crucial enzyme in the production of testosterone. It's found at the testes and is a rate limiting phase in the creation of testosterone. Boosting the activity of StAR is among the main ways that DAA helps the body produce a lot more testosterone and it was found in human studies that D Aspartic Acid is able to generate roughly a 30 % increased testosterone production! Aromatase is a nasty enzyme that is responsible for changing testosterone to estrogen within the body. It is what robs the bodybuilder of the robust effects of testosterone and changes the balance of your hormones. As we age, we produce even more aromatase and that's usually the reason why you see males getting fat, soft and flabby while they age.
